On the territory of Donbass in the column of Ukrainian technology was observed intelligence chemical machine "Kashalot". "Sperm whales" were made at one time in the USSR with the aim of using them in the areas of radiation and chemical contamination to study its scale. The armament of such a machine can be called, rather, symbolic for conducting full-fledged military operations. This machine gun Kalashnikov caliber 7.62.
